The Governance Gap

AI systems are powerful. They are also unpredictable. Without governance:

  • Chatbots make unauthorized promises
  • Recommendations violate compliance rules
  • Generated content contradicts brand guidelines
  • Agents take actions beyond their authority

The gap between AI capability and policy compliance creates risk.

What is Zen

Zen is a rule enforcement layer that sits between AI capabilities and outputs:

User Request

┌─────────────┐
│    Jin      │ ← AI processes request
└──────┬──────┘

┌─────────────┐
│    Zen      │ ← Rules evaluated
└──────┬──────┘

  Compliant Output

Every AI output passes through Zen before reaching users.

Rule Definition

Rules defined in a declarative language:

# zen-rules.yaml

rules:
  - name: no_competitor_mentions
    description: Never mention competitor brands
    applies_to: [chat, content_generation]
    condition: |
      output.contains_any(competitors.list)
    action: rewrite
    rewrite_instruction: |
      Remove competitor mentions, focus on our products

  - name: price_accuracy
    description: Prices must match catalog
    applies_to: [chat, recommendations]
    condition: |
      output.mentions_price AND
      output.price != product.current_price
    action: block
    fallback: |
      Please check our website for current pricing

  - name: medical_claims
    description: No medical claims for supplements
    applies_to: [content_generation, chat]
    condition: |
      product.category == "supplements" AND
      output.contains_medical_claim
    action: rewrite
    rewrite_instruction: |
      Remove medical claims, use approved language only

Rule Types

Content Rules

Control what AI can say:

- name: brand_voice
  condition: output.tone != "friendly_professional"
  action: rewrite

- name: no_profanity
  condition: output.contains_profanity
  action: block

Data Rules

Control what AI can access:

- name: customer_data_scope
  condition: |
    request.accesses_customer_data AND
    request.customer_id != session.customer_id
  action: block

- name: pii_masking
  condition: output.contains_pii
  action: mask

Action Rules

Control what AI can do:

- name: refund_limit
  applies_to: [support_agent]
  condition: |
    action.type == "issue_refund" AND
    action.amount > 100
  action: require_approval

- name: discount_cap
  condition: |
    action.type == "apply_discount" AND
    action.percent > 20
  action: block

Enforcement Modes

Block

Prevent output entirely, use fallback:

User: "What do you think of [competitor]?"

[Jin generates comparison]
[Zen blocks: competitor mention]

Response: "I'd be happy to help you find the right product
from our catalog. What features are most important to you?"

Rewrite

Modify output to comply:

User: "Tell me about this supplement"

[Jin generates: "This supplement cures headaches..."]
[Zen rewrites: medical claim]

Response: "This supplement is formulated to support overall
wellness. Individual results may vary."

Flag

Allow output but alert for review:

[Output allowed]
[Alert sent to compliance team]
[Logged for audit]

Require Approval

Pause for human approval:

Agent: "I'd like to issue a $150 refund for this customer"

[Zen: requires approval for refunds > $100]

System: "This action requires supervisor approval.
Sending request to @supervisor..."

Audit Trail

Every rule evaluation logged:

{
  "request_id": "req_abc123",
  "timestamp": "2023-09-20T14:30:00Z",
  "rules_evaluated": 12,
  "rules_triggered": 1,
  "triggered_rule": "price_accuracy",
  "action_taken": "block",
  "original_output": "[redacted]",
  "final_output": "Please check our website for current pricing",
  "latency_ms": 8
}

Performance

Zen adds minimal latency:

  • Average: 8ms
  • p99: 25ms

Rules evaluated in parallel. Common rules cached.
